Establishes a pilot program to enhance Medicaid reimbursement for assisted living programs with specific workforce demographic requirements.
The bill establishes an assisted living program reimbursement pilot program to provide enhanced Medicaid reimbursement to qualifying assisted living programs. To qualify, at least 70% of the facility's staff must voluntarily self-identify as Black, Hispanic, or Asian. The capitated rates of payment will increase from 31% to 50% over five years. Facilities must submit an annual certification to the department of health verifying compliance. The commissioner may audit participating facilities to ensure compliance. Non-compliant facilities may be removed from the pilot program.
